Summary: Hosted by Joe, Paddy and Jesse, Linux Luddites is a podcast where we try all the latest free and open source software and then decide that we like the old stuff better. Join us for news, reviews, and interviews with key industry players, as we bring you all you need to know from around the Linux and FOSS world.
